Reggie Theus and the Eternal Lack of Direction
Sactown Royalty —
Over at FanHouse, I have offered up Reggie Theus as the first potential victim of the midseason guillotine.
Of course, there are two competing questions when you consider any potential coaching change: should it happen? Will it happen? That FanHouse joint is tailored to the latter question ... and the evidence is pretty strong. You have to think that if the Maloofs and Geoff Petrie liked the way things went last year, they'd have guaranteed the 2009-10. I mean, it's not like these dudes are shy about locking folks in. Twenty-five or more NBA teams would ...

Empty the Bench —
... There are also concerns with head coach Reggie Theus. I’ll defer to the esteemed Mr. Ziller here, who had an excellent post about Theus last week. Basically, the Kings are losing, and they’re losing to bad teams. The team isn’t playing well, including starters Mikki Moore and Kevin Martin. Rotations are becoming muddled. Players are chaffing with Theus and he doesn’t have a strong relationship with the core. He also doesn’t have a contract. According to Ziller, it all adds up to Sacramento’s head coach occupying the hottest seat in the ...
